FastStone is arguably the closest modern equivalent to the classic ACDSee experience. It features a highly similar tree-view navigation panel, a lightning-fast image rendering engine, and robust batch conversion tools. It is entirely free for home use and actively supported on modern operating systems like Windows 10 and 11. 2. IrfanView (Free)

What made ACDSee 5.0 so special? Unlike modern software that often forces users into rigid import workflows, ACDSee 5.0 worked directly with your existing folder structure, allowing you to view and manage images without lengthy imports or complex catalogs. With support for a wide range of image formats—including JPEG, PNG, GIF, BMP, TIFF, and even early Canon RAW (CRW) and Photoshop (PSD) files—it truly lived up to its reputation as a versatile "universal viewer".
